简要总结
In this era of pharmaceutical and technological advancements, gaining insights into prevalent insulin administration practices under real-life conditions becomes pivotal for healthcare professionals. The investigators aim to explore insulin injection habits through an online survey among a broad, unselected group of participants with type 1 and type 2 diabetes undergoing daily prandial and/or basal insulin treatment. Eligible participants will access and complete the survey at their convenience after providing online informed consent within the study period
详细描述
HYPOTHESIS The study hypothesis posits that there is significant variability in the practices of insulin administration among patients with diabetes using daily insulin injections. This diversity in administration practices may have a notable impact on the overall efficacy of treatment regimens and the successful management of the disease, thereby emphasizing the need for a comprehensive understanding of these practices to enhance patient outcomes and optimize diabetes care.
OBJECTIVES The main objective of the study is to comprehensively assess and characterize the diverse insulin administration practices among individuals with diabetes using injections, focusing on both prandial and basal insulin. By employing an online survey methodology and targeting a broad demographic through a diabetes information platform Canal Diabetes, the investigators aim to gain valuable insights into the variability, challenges, and overall patterns of insulin administration. The findings will contribute to a better understanding of real-world practices, facilitating improvements in patient guidance and optimizing diabetes care strategies.
STUDY DESIGN The study follows a cross-sectional observational design, allowing the investigators to capture a snapshot of the current insulin administration practices via an online questionnaire among the diverse population of diabetes patients using multiple insulin injections.
STUDY PROCEDURE AND SCHEDULE The study, focusing on insulin administration practices among participants with diabetes using multiple insulin injections, will employ a two-month online survey accessible on the designated online platform Canal Diabetes. Recruitment efforts through the diabetes information platform Canal Diabetes will inform eligible participants about the study's voluntary nature, emphasizing response confidentiality. Participants meeting the criteria, will access and complete the online informed consent and survey at their convenience within the designated two-month period. Post-survey, collected data will be securely stored and anonymized for subsequent analysis.
STUDY DURATION The anticipated duration of this study will be 4 months, with subject recruitment set to begin in July 2024 and aiming for the completion of statistical analysis by the 31st of October 2024.

入选标准
- •Individuals aged 18 or above
- •Individuals diagnosed with diabetes (type 1 or type 2 diabetes)
- •Individuals receiving multiple daily doses of insulin
排除标准
- •Individuals utilizing continuous subcutaneous insulin infusion
- •Individuals engaging in sensor-augmented pump therapy
- •Individuals using automatic insulin delivery systems
